In Cumming, GA, expect to pay between $450 and $1200 for a typical EV charger installation, though prices can range from $149 for basic setups to $3000 for more complex jobs. The main cost drivers are the charger level (Level 1 vs. Level 2), the specifics of your home's electrical panel, and how far the new outlet needs to be from the panel.

The choice between Level 1 (120 volts) and Level 2 (240 volts) depends on the client's charging needs. Level 1 is slower, ideal for overnight charging for low-mileage drivers, and generally has a lower installation cost, starting as low as $149.12. Level 2 offers much faster charging and is preferred by most EV owners for daily use but requires a 240V circuit, typically costing between $451 and $3000 for installation, depending on complexity.
A 'premium' EV charger installation, priced between $1201 and $3000, typically involves significant electrical panel upgrades to accommodate a Level 2 charger, longer conduit runs, or complex wiring due to distance from the electrical panel or challenging structural elements. The cost of the charger equipment itself can add $500-$700 to this total.
Yes, installations where the new outlet or Level 1 charger is within a few feet of the breaker panel are generally the least expensive. These 'basic' jobs can start around $450, as they minimize the need for extensive wiring and labor.
Yes, for most Level 2 EV charger installations and potentially for new dedicated circuits, permits and inspections are likely required by local Cumming, GA, authorities. It's crucial for contractors to verify current local regulations and factor these costs and timelines into their project bids.
